在学习Netty前的必需知识:NIO。如果不了解可以看这篇:手动搭建I/O网络通信框架3:NIO编程模型,升级改造聊天室。 对于BIO和AIO可以只看文字了解一下,但是NIO编程模型最好还是动手实践一下,毕竟NIO目前是使用最广的。还有一篇Netty实战SpringBoot+Netty+WebSoc ...
转载
2021-10-18 01:26:00
1112阅读
2评论
Netty 是最流行的 NIO 框架,它已经得到成百上千的商业、商用项目验证,许多框架和开源组件的底层 rpc 都是使用的 Netty
转载
2021-06-22 17:02:55
209阅读
Netty 入门实战异步事件驱动的Java开源网络应用程序框架,用于快速开发可维护
原创
2022-01-12 11:19:01
317阅读
Netty 入门实战异步事件驱动的Java开源网络应用程序框架,用于快速开发可维护的高性能协议服务器和客户端。Netty 项目旨在为可维护的高性能和高可伸缩性协议服务器和客户端的快速开发提供一个异步事件驱动的网络应用框架和工具。Netty 是一个 NIO 客户机服务器框架,可以快速简单地开发网络应用程序,如协议服务器和客户机。它极大地简化了网络编程,如 TCP 和 UDP 套接字服务器的开发。“快速和简单”并不意味着产生的应用程序会受到可维护性或性能问题的影响。Netty 是根据实现许多协议(
原创
2021-06-09 15:38:41
320阅读
什么是Netty?Netty 是一个利用 Java 的高级网络的能力,隐藏其背后的复杂性而提供一个易于使用的 API 的客户端/服务器框架。 Netty 是一个广泛使用的 Java 网络编程框架(Netty 在 2011 年获得了Duke's Choice Award,见https://www.java.net/dukeschoice/2011)。
原创
2021-06-08 15:56:54
299阅读
什么是Netty? Netty 是一个利用 Java 的高级网络的能力,隐藏其背后的复杂性而提供一个易于使用的 API 的客户端/服务器框架。 Netty 是一个广泛使用的 Java 网络编程框架(Netty 在 2011 年获得了Duke's Choice Award,见https://.j
转载
2021-01-07 16:05:00
170阅读
2评论
Netty什么是Netty?Netty 是一个利用 Java 的高级网络的能力,隐藏其背后的复杂性而提供一个易于使用的 API 的客户端/服务器框架。
Netty 是一个广泛使用的 Java 网络编程框架(Netty 在 2011 年获得了Duke's Choice Award,见https://www.java.net/dukeschoice/2011)。它活跃和成长于用户社区,像大型公
转载
2020-02-27 16:11:00
112阅读
2评论
一、什么是NettyNetty官网上是这样定义Netty的:Netty is an asynchronous event-driven network application framework for rapid development of maintainable high performance protocol servers & clients.用人话(Google翻译)的话来
原创
2022-11-22 13:29:34
492阅读
目录什么是Netty?Netty和Tomcat有什么区别?为什么Netty受欢迎?Netty为什么并发高五种常见的IO模型Netty为什么传输快为什么说Netty封装好?他有三种使用模式:什么是Netty?Netty 是一个利用 Java 的高级网络的能力,隐藏其背后的复杂性而提供一个易于使用的 API 的客户端/服务器框架。 Netty是一个
转载
2022-02-14 10:06:41
359阅读
一、Netty简介Netty是基于JavaNIO的异步事件驱动的网络应用框架,使用Netty可以快速开发网络应用,Netty提供了高层次的抽象来简化TCP和UDP服务器的编程,但是你仍然可以使用底层的API。Netty的内部实现是很复杂的,但是Netty提供了简单易用的API从网络处理代码中解耦业务逻辑。Netty是完全基于NIO实现的,所以整个Netty都是异步的。Netty是最流行的NIO框架
原创
精选
2021-05-13 14:32:14
569阅读
目录□ ifconfig查看IP号□ 什么是Docker镜像容器镜像与容器的关系仓库仓库注册服务器□ Docker 常用命令镜像命令Docker imagesDocker search 镜像名docker pull 镜像名docker rmi 镜像名ID容器命令新建并启动容器列出当前所有正在运行的容器查看docker容器使用资源默认输出只返回当前状态只输出指定的容器退出容器启动容器重启容器停止容
转载
2023-07-17 16:23:47
148阅读
10分钟,快速学会docker1 总体框图2 快速入门2.1 获取镜像2.2 查看本地镜像2.3 运行镜像2.4 查看正在运行的容器2.5 修改容器2.6 删除容器2.7 提交容器2.8 通过dockerfile构建镜像跑成容器2.9 保存文件和重新加载2.10 其他摘抄小狐狸的笔记入门操作3 多容器部署3.1 运行nginx容器,并查看ip3.2 运行alpine容器通过curl访问nginx
转载
2023-09-20 15:50:05
74阅读
“快速简便”并不意味着最终的应用程序会受到可维护性或性能问题的影响。Netty经过精心设计,具有丰富的协议,如FTP,SMTP,HTTP以及各种二进制和基于文本的传统协议。因此,Netty成功地找到了一种在不妥协的情况下实现易于开发,性能,稳定性和灵活性的方法。
原创
2019-08-24 17:18:24
693阅读
一. Docker简介1.1 什么是虚拟化?在计算机中,虚拟化(英语:Virtualization)是一种资源管理技术,是将计算机的各种实体资源,如服务器、网络、内存及存储等,予以抽象、转换后呈现出来,打破实体结构间的不可切割的障碍,使用户可以比原本的组态更好的方式来应用这些资源。这些资源的新虚拟部份是不受现有资源的架设方式,地域或物理组态所限制。一般所指的虚拟化资源包括计算能力和资料存储。在实际
原创
2023-09-07 14:53:21
58阅读
9、状态编程9.1、Flink 中的状态在流处理中,数据是连续不断到来和处理的。每个任务进行计算处理时,可以基于当前数据直接转换得到输出结果;也可以依赖一些其他数据。这些由一个任务维护,并且用来计算输出结果的所有数据,就叫作这个任务的状态。9.1.1、有状态算子在 Flink 中,算子任务可以分为无状态和有状态两种情况。 无状态的算子任务只需要观察每个独立事件,根据当前输入的数据直接转换输出结果,
转载
2024-03-01 15:06:21
347阅读
保存→选择谷歌浏览器即可运行成功,页面如图四,点击一下按钮“点我”,即可弹出警示框图三图四内嵌式(在he
转载
2023-07-22 18:36:56
66阅读
前面我们学习了模型设计中的内嵌模式与引用模式的使用,本篇我们来看看在模型设计中如何套用常见的设计模式来降低设计难度,提高查询效率。本文简单介绍了MongoDB的模型设计中的三大类常用设计模式:表现形式类、数据访问类 和 组织结构类。通过学习这些设计模式,使我们可以在模型设计场景中恰当地套用这些设计模式,从而达到提升数据读写效率 和 降低资源的需求,最终得到一个合适的文档模型。
前面我们学习了模型
转载
2021-06-24 23:42:00
184阅读
2评论
参考视频教程资料: Node.js+Koa2框架生态实战从零模拟新浪微博 : (http://www.notescloud.top/goods/detail/1222)<http://www.notescloud.top/goods/detail/1222 Node.js仿知乎服务端深入理解RESTfulAPI
转载
2021-08-30 16:12:23
709阅读
好的,下面是Spark入门教程:# 1. Spark概述Spark是一种基于内存计算的大数据处理框架,它提供了高效的分布式数据处理能力,使得处理大规模数据变得更加容易。Spark最初是由加州大学伯克利分校AMPLab实验室开发的,后来被捐赠给了Apache软件基金会,成为了Apache的顶级项目。Spark最主要的特点是内存计算,它能够将数据存储在内存中进行计算,大大提高了计算速度。此外,Spar
转载
2023-07-28 20:32:54
1350阅读
在探究hbase的功能之前,为什么要设计出这样一套新的存储架构。关系数据库系统的问题:hbase是一个分布式的,持久的、强一致性的存储系统,具有近似最优的写性能(能使用I/o利用率达到饱和)和出色的读性能,它充分利用了磁盘空间,支持特定列族切换可选压缩算法。...
原创
2021-11-16 10:14:04
321阅读